Inscription

66,825,304

Inscription Details

Inscription ID
a7ede8......792ci0
Number
66,825,304
Owner
bc1p93......86mcwt
Output Size
546 Sats
Content Type
text/plain
Content Size
0.09 KB
Creation Date
March 31, 2024. 477 days ago
Creation Fee
2,665 Sats
Creation Tx
a7ede8......d5792c
Block
837130
Previous
e61c2b......a5f9i0
Next
3c2334......5c58i0

Satoshi Details

Sat Number
1,166,773,437,778,628
Sat Name
fovwhbrxvtl
Sat Creation Block
256,709
Sat Creation Date
9/8/2013
Rarity
common